Seconde partie de la carte d' Asia/Indies Indochina. D’ANVILLE 1752 map


Artist/engraver/cartographer: Jean Baptiste Bourguignon d'Anville. Provenance: The map was extracted from a composite atlas of early 18th century maps, the latest of which was dated c1754. Type: Large antique 18th century atlas wall map, printed on thick, good quality paper with original outline hand colour/color and decorative title cartouche. The map includes the East Indies (present-day Indonesia) and Indochina
